From: <security@xenproject.org>
Subject: vtd: prune (and rename) cache flush functions

Rename __iommu_flush_cache to iommu_sync_cache and remove
iommu_flush_cache_page. Also remove the iommu_flush_cache_entry
wrapper and just use iommu_sync_cache instead. Note the _entry suffix
was meaningless as the wrapper was already taking a size parameter in
bytes. While there also constify the addr parameter.

No functional change intended.

This is part of XSA-321.

Reviewed-by: Jan Beulich <jbeulich@suse.com>
